What is Merge Galaxy?

Merge Galaxy is a casual arcade game that mixes the logic of a merge puzzle with the physics of a gravity simulation. You have a circular orbit zone and a queue of planets waiting to be launched. Fire a planet in, and it will drift until it touches another planet of the same size. When two matching planets collide they merge into a single larger one. Keep chaining merges up through the size ladder until the two biggest objects in the game smash together and vanish, clearing space and earning a big points bonus. If the stack grows too tall and planets spill out of orbit, the game ends. The rating is 4.5 out of 5 from over 400 players, which reflects how well the one-more-go tension holds up.

How to aim and launch planets

Controls are the same on desktop and mobile. Grab the planet at the bottom of the screen and drag it like a slingshot. A dotted path shows exactly where the planet will land before you let go, so there is no guessing.

Scoring and the planet size ladder

Every merge earns points, and bigger merges earn more. The planets scale from a small rocky body all the way up to a radiant sun at the top of the chain. Getting to the sun requires repeated high-level merges, so each run is a long sequence of decisions about where to place each incoming planet.

Planet tierHow you get itPoints value
Tiny rockStarting piece from queueBase
Small planetMerge 2 tiny rocksLow
Medium planetMerge 2 small planetsMedium
Large planetMerge 2 medium planetsHigh
Gas giantMerge 2 large planetsVery high
SunMerge 2 gas giantsMaximum (pair disappears)
